Security Features of PayPal for Forex Withdrawals

When it comes to keeping your hard-earned money safe, PayPal has got you covered with its advanced security features that act like a fortress around your transactions, making sure they stay protected from online threats.

PayPal’s fraud prevention system is designed to detect and block unauthorized access to your account by monitoring all transactions for suspicious activity. This system uses machine learning algorithms to analyze data patterns and identify potential fraud before any damage can be done.

In addition to this, PayPal also offers two-factor authentication (2FA), which adds an extra layer of protection when logging in or making transactions. With 2FA enabled, you will need to provide a unique code generated by an authentication app or sent via SMS before accessing your account.

This ensures that even if someone gains access to your login credentials, they won’t be able to perform any transaction without the additional verification step. These security features make PayPal one of the most trusted payment platforms for forex traders looking for an easy and secure withdrawal process.

Tips for a Smooth PayPal Withdrawal Process

To ensure a seamless experience during your PayPal withdrawal process, implement these helpful tips. As with any financial transaction, there are common pitfalls to avoid and best practices to follow. Here are a few things to keep in mind:

  • Double-check all details: Before initiating the withdrawal, make sure that all the information entered is accurate. Verify the account number and email address associated with your PayPal account.

  • Keep an eye on exchange rates: If you’re withdrawing funds from a foreign currency account, be aware of current exchange rates. Check if your broker applies any fees or commissions for currency conversion.

  • Monitor transaction history: After the withdrawal has been initiated, keep track of its progress by monitoring your PayPal transaction history.

By following these simple steps, you can avoid potential errors and enjoy a smooth and hassle-free PayPal withdrawal process. Remember that it’s always better to err on the side of caution when dealing with financial transactions.

Can I withdraw funds from my forex trading account to someone else’s PayPal account?

When it comes to withdrawing funds from your forex trading account, you may be wondering if it’s possible to transfer the money to someone else’s PayPal account.

However, this raises some security concerns as well as potential issues with PayPal’s terms and conditions.

It’s important to note that transferring funds to another person’s PayPal account could violate anti-money laundering regulations and lead to frozen accounts or legal action.

Therefore, it may be best to consider alternative payment methods such as bank transfers or e-wallets that allow for secure and hassle-free transactions without compromising on safety.
